     Desmond FitzJohn Lloyd FitzGerald, 27th Knight of Glin was born on 12 March 1862.3 He was the son of Desmond John Edmund FitzGerald, 26th Knight of Glin and Isabella Lloyd Apjohn.2 He married Lady Rachael Charlotte Wyndham-Quin, daughter of Windham Thomas Wyndham-Quin, 4th Earl of Dunraven and Mount-Earl and Florence Elizabeth Kerr, on 28 October 1897.1 He died on 17 September 1936 at age 74.1
     Desmond FitzJohn Lloyd FitzGerald, 27th Knight of Glin was educated at Cheltenham College, Cheltenham, Gloucestershire, England.3 He gained the title of 27th Knight of Glin in 1895.1 He gained the rank of Captain in the service of the South Irish Horse.3 He held the office of Deputy Lieutenant (D.L.) of County Limerick.1 He held the office of Justice of the Peace (J.P.) for County Limerick.1 He held the office of High Sheriff of County Limerick in 1904.3 He gained the rank of Captain in the service of the 3rd Battalion, Royal Dublin Fusiliers.3 He sold Riddlestown Park, which he inherited.3 He lived at Glin Castle, County Limerick, Ireland.3

     Desmond John Villiers FitzGerald, 29th Knight of Glin was born on 13 July 1937.2 He is the son of Desmond Wyndham Otho FitzGerald, 28th Knight of Glin and Veronica Villiers.2 He married, firstly, Louise Vava Lucia Henriette de la Falaise, daughter of Alain de la Falaise, Comte de la Falaise and Maxine Birley, on 6 October 1966.3 He and Louise Vava Lucia Henriette de la Falaise were divorced in 1970.2 He married, secondly, Olda Ann Willes, daughter of Major Thomas Vincent Windham Willes and Margaret Georgina Wakefield-Saunders, on 12 August 1970.2
     Desmond John Villiers FitzGerald, 29th Knight of Glin was educated at Stowe School, Buckingham, Buckinghamshire, England.2 He succeeded to the title of 29th Knight of Glin in 1949.1 He graduated from University of British Columbia, Vancouver, British Columbia, Canada, with a Bachelor of Arts (B.A.).2 He graduated from Harvard University, Cambridge, Massachusetts, U.S.A., in 1962 with a Master of Arts (M.A.).2 He was assistant keeper and deputy keeper of the Department of Furniture and Woodwork between 1965 and 1975 at Victoria and Albert Museum, London, England.2 He co-authored the book Irish Houses and Landscapes.4 He co-authored the book Ireland Observed: a handbook to the buildings and antiquities, published 1970.2 He wrote the book Irish Architectural Drawings.4 Editor of Georgian Furniture.4 He wrote the book Irish Portraits.4 He was invested as a Fellow, Society of Antiquaries (F.S.A.) in 1970.2 He co-authored the book The Music From Norfolk House, published 1972.2 He was Irish Agent for Christie Mansion and Woods Ltd in 1975.2 He co-authored the book Lost Desmesnes: Irish Landscape Gardening 1660-1845, published 1976.2 He wrote the book Irish Furniture, published 1978.2 He wrote the book The Painters of Ireland, published 1978.2 He wrote the book Vanishing Country Houses of Ireland, published 1988.2 He wrote the book The Watercolours of Ireland, published 1994.2 He was an architectural historian.3 He lived at Glin Castle, Glin, County Limerick, Ireland.1 He was awarded the honorary degree of Doctor of Literature (D.Litt.) by Trinity College, Dublin University, Dublin, County Dublin, Ireland, in 2002.2
